💔 Emmerdale’s Charlie Webb Sends Emotional Father’s Day Messages to Jeff Hordley and Ex Matthew Wolfenden
Former Emmerdale star Charlie Webb has tugged at fans’ heartstrings with a pair of heartfelt Father’s Day tributes — one to her on-screen dad Jeff Hordley, and another to her real-life ex-partner Matthew Wolfenden.
Charlie, best known for her long-running role as Debbie Dingle in the ITV soap, took to Instagram on Sunday, June 15, to share her emotions on what she called a “bittersweet” day.
🌾 A Message to Her On-Screen Dad
In her first post, Charlie shared a striking monochrome snap of herself dressed up as Jeff Hordley’s character Cain Dingle, complete with his signature dark brows and intense glare. Fans of the soap will recall that Debbie and Cain’s tumultuous father-daughter bond was one of the show’s most compelling relationships for nearly two decades.
“To this father of mine,” Charlie wrote warmly, adding: “That time I dressed up as you. The eyebrows are so accurate it’s scary.”
The post resonated with Emmerdale fans, especially as Jeff’s character Cain continues to grieve on-screen following the shocking death of his son Nate — a tragedy he is unaware was orchestrated by John Sugden.
💔 A Tribute to Her Real-Life Ex
Shortly afterward, Charlie shared a touching montage dedicated to her former partner, fellow Emmerdale star Matthew Wolfenden. The couple, who met on set in 2006 and married in 2018, welcomed three sons before announcing their separation in 2023.
Posting a carousel of sweet family photos featuring Matthew and their boys, Charlie captioned it: “Thanks for being a great dad to the boys @matthewwolfenden55, they adore you ❤️”
The message comes months after Matthew publicly reflected on their split, calling it “a big shock,” but emphasizing that they remain friends and committed co-parents. “We had the best 15 years together and we got the best three kids out of it,” he told fans recently.
🌏 What’s Next for Debbie Dingle?
Charlie made her Emmerdale debut in 2002 and was a central figure in the Dales until taking a break in 2019. She briefly returned between 2020 and 2021, but her character’s future was recently addressed on-screen when her daughter Sarah phoned Debbie — only to learn she had married Chris and moved to Australia without telling her family.
The revelation dashed fans’ hopes that Debbie might return to the village, especially amid the arrival of Joe Tate.
